Class ExpressionInvoker
java.lang.Object
com.flowable.serviceregistry.engine.impl.invoker.AbstractServiceInvoker
com.flowable.serviceregistry.engine.impl.invoker.expression.ExpressionInvoker
- All Implemented Interfaces:
ServiceInvoker
-
Field Summary
FieldsFields inherited from class com.flowable.serviceregistry.engine.impl.invoker.AbstractServiceInvoker
serviceRegistryEngineConfiguration
-
Constructor Summary
ConstructorsConstructorDescriptionExpressionInvoker
(ServiceRegistryEngineConfiguration serviceRegistryEngineConfiguration, com.fasterxml.jackson.databind.ObjectMapper objectMapper) -
Method Summary
Modifier and TypeMethodDescriptionprotected ServiceInvocationResultResponse
asInvocationResponse
(com.fasterxml.jackson.databind.JsonNode resultNode) protected Expression
createExpression
(ServiceDefinitionModel serviceDefinition, ServiceOperation serviceOperation) invoke
(ServiceDefinitionModel serviceDefinition, ServiceOperation serviceOperation, ServiceInvocationContext context) Methods inherited from class com.flowable.serviceregistry.engine.impl.invoker.AbstractServiceInvoker
completeInputParameter, createAndInitializeServiceInvocationVariablesContainer
-
Field Details
-
KEY
- See Also:
-
-
Constructor Details
-
ExpressionInvoker
public ExpressionInvoker(ServiceRegistryEngineConfiguration serviceRegistryEngineConfiguration, com.fasterxml.jackson.databind.ObjectMapper objectMapper)
-
-
Method Details
-
invoke
public ServiceInvocationResultResponse invoke(ServiceDefinitionModel serviceDefinition, ServiceOperation serviceOperation, ServiceInvocationContext context) -
asInvocationResponse
protected ServiceInvocationResultResponse asInvocationResponse(com.fasterxml.jackson.databind.JsonNode resultNode) -
createExpression
protected Expression createExpression(ServiceDefinitionModel serviceDefinition, ServiceOperation serviceOperation)
-